Current prospects for ASTROD Inertial Sensor
Abstract
The Astrodynamical Space Test of Relativity using Optical Devices (ASTROD) is a multi-purpose relativity mission concept. ASTROD's scientific goals are the measurement of relativistic and solar system parameters to unprecedented precision, and the detection and observation of low-frequency gravitational waves to frequencies down to $5\times10^{-6}$ Hz. To accomplish its goals, ASTROD will employ a constellation of drag-free satellites, aiming for a residual acceleration noise of (0.3-1)$\times$ 10$^{-15}$ m s$^{-2}$ Hz$^{-1/2}$ at 0.1 mHz. Noise sources and strategies for improving present acceleration noise levels are reported.
